Endoplasmic reticulum
|
Carries materials from one part of the cell to another
|
|
Golgi bodies
|
Receive materials from the endoplasmic reticulum and send them to other parts of the cell.
|
|
Cytoplasm
|
The area between the cell membrane and the nucleus. It contains a gel-like fluid in which many different organelles are found.
|
|
Mitochondria
|
Is called the powerhouse of the cell, because they produce most of the energy the cell needs to carry out the functions.
|
|
Endoplasmic Reticulum
|
A maze of passageways, these passageways carry proteins and other materials from one part of the cell to another.
|
|
Ribosomes
|
Function as factories to produce proteins. May be attached to the outer surfaces of the endoplasmic reticulum, or they may flot free in the cytoplasm.
|
|
Chloroplast
|
Capture energy from the sunlight and ust it to produce food for the cell. Gives plants their green color.
